
Cost of Commercial Groundskeeping in Fort Walton Beach
The cost of commercial groundskeeping in Fort Walton Beach, FL can vary widely depending on a range of factors. Whether you own an office complex, a retail establishment, or a hospitality venue, maintaining a well-kept landscape is crucial for creating a positive impression. Understanding the factors that influence the cost and the common tasks involved can help you budget effectively for your groundskeeping needs.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Property Size: Larger properties require more time and resources to maintain, leading to higher costs.
- Frequency of Service: More frequent maintenance visits will increase overall costs.
- Type of Landscaping: Complex landscapes with intricate designs or specialty plants can be more expensive to maintain.
- Seasonal Needs: Costs can fluctuate based on seasonal requirements such as leaf removal in the fall or snow removal in the winter.
- Labor Costs: The cost of labor in Fort Walton Beach can affect the overall pricing, particularly for specialized services.
- Equipment and Materials: The types of equipment and materials needed for specific tasks, such as fertilizers or irrigation systems, can impact costs.
- Additional Services: Extra services like pest control, tree trimming, or aeration can add to the overall expense.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Fort Walton Beach, FL) |
---|---|
Lawn Mowing | $50 - $100 per visit |
Edging and Trimming | $30 - $60 per visit |
Leaf Removal | $75 - $150 per visit |
Mulching | $200 - $400 per application |
Irrigation System Maintenance | $100 - $300 per visit |
Fertilization | $50 - $100 per application |
Tree Trimming | $200 - $500 per tree |
Pest Control | $75 - $150 per visit |
Seasonal Flower Planting | $100 - $300 per planting |
